STILLWATER, Oklahoma -- The OKlahoma State baseball team fell behind early on Tuesday, but responded to grab its first win of a two-game series with Florida Gulf Coast (14-9), 5-3.

FGCU took a 2-0 lead early when Zach Maxfield hit a two-run home run to left field.

After that inning, OSU pitcher Andrew Heaney retired eight of the next nine batters he faced and pitched six scoreless innings. Ian McCarthy came in to relieve him in the eighth inning, gave up one unearned run and struck out four of the eight batters he faced.

Oklahoma State took the lead in the next inning, scoring all four of its runs with two outs on the board. Dane Phillips started the scoring with an RBI double to bring Luis Uribe across the plate. In the next at bat, Kevin Chambers hit a double to bring Phillips home, immediately followed by a Dusty Harvard RBI single to bring him home. Harvard stole second to move into scoring position, and Davis Duren then drove him in for the score.

The Cowboys finish the series with the Eagles Wednesday before hosting Nebraska in a Big 12 weekend series.
